The United Arab Emirates has asked France to provide immediate consular support to Pavel Durov

Last Saturday, Telegram CEO Pavel Durov was arrested in France in connection with a cybercrime investigation, and the UAE requested consular services for him.
"The UAE is closely following the case of its citizen Pavel Durov, founder of Telegram, who was arrested by French authorities at Paris-Le Bourget airport," the UAE foreign ministry said in a statement. "The UAE has requested the French government to urgently provide him with all necessary consular services."
Durov was born in Russia and moved to Dubai (where Telegram is headquartered) in 2017. He became an Emirati citizen in February 2021 and naturalized as a French citizen in August 2021, gaining European Union citizenship.
